1. Understanding the OBD2 Port in Your Mercedes C-Class

The OBD2 (On-Board Diagnostics II) port is a standardized interface used to access a vehicle’s computer system for diagnostics and monitoring. According to a study by the Society of Automotive Engineers (SAE), OBD2 systems have been mandatory in all cars sold in the US since 1996, ensuring a common platform for emission control and vehicle diagnostics. The OBD2 port in your Mercedes C-Class is a crucial component for vehicle maintenance and troubleshooting.

1.1. What is an OBD2 Port?

An OBD2 port, or On-Board Diagnostics II port, is a standardized connector in your vehicle that allows access to the car’s computer system. SAE conducted comprehensive research, demonstrating that this port provides real-time data and diagnostic trouble codes (DTCs) to help identify issues within the vehicle. It’s essentially a gateway to your car’s health information.

1.2. Why is the OBD2 Port Important for Your Mercedes C-Class?

The OBD2 port is essential for diagnosing issues, monitoring performance, and ensuring your Mercedes C-Class runs efficiently. According to the EPA, OBD2 systems help reduce emissions by monitoring engine performance and alerting drivers to potential problems. Regular use of an OBD2 scanner can catch minor issues before they become major, costly repairs.

1.3. Common Uses of the OBD2 Port

The OBD2 port has several practical applications, including:

  • Reading and clearing diagnostic trouble codes (DTCs)
  • Monitoring real-time engine data (e.g., RPM, temperature, speed)
  • Performing emissions tests
  • Programming and resetting certain vehicle functions

According to a study by the National Institute for Automotive Service Excellence (ASE), technicians use OBD2 scanners to quickly identify and resolve issues, saving time and improving diagnostic accuracy.

2. Locating the OBD2 Port in Your Mercedes C-Class

Finding the OBD2 port in your Mercedes C-Class is straightforward. It is generally located in the driver’s side footwell, under the dashboard.

2.1. Step-by-Step Guide to Finding the OBD2 Port

  1. Check Under the Dashboard: Look beneath the steering wheel, near the pedals.
  2. Feel Around: The port is usually in an easily accessible location.
  3. Use a Flashlight: If it’s hard to see, a flashlight can help illuminate the area.
  4. Consult Your Manual: If you’re still unsure, your vehicle’s manual will have a diagram.

2.2. Common Locations in Different Mercedes C-Class Models

While the OBD2 port is typically in the same general area, slight variations can occur based on the model year and trim level. Here’s a table summarizing common locations:

Model Year Location
2015-2021 (W205) Under the dashboard, driver’s side, near the center console
2022-Present (W206) Under the dashboard, driver’s side, more towards the door panel
Older Models Under the dashboard, but may require removing a small panel for access

4. Using the OBD2 Scanner with Your Mercedes C-Class

Once you have your OBD2 scanner, using it is a straightforward process. Proper usage ensures accurate diagnostics and prevents potential issues.

4.1. Step-by-Step Instructions for Connecting the Scanner

  1. Locate the OBD2 Port: Find the port under the dashboard on the driver’s side.
  2. Plug in the Scanner: Connect the OBD2 scanner to the port.
  3. Turn on the Ignition: Turn the key to the “on” position without starting the engine.
  4. Power on the Scanner: Follow the scanner’s instructions to power it on.
  5. Select Your Vehicle: Choose the make, model, and year of your Mercedes C-Class.
  6. Start the Diagnostic Scan: Follow the scanner’s prompts to begin the diagnostic process.

4.2. Reading and Interpreting Diagnostic Trouble Codes (DTCs)

After the scan, the OBD2 scanner will display any Diagnostic Trouble Codes (DTCs). These codes indicate specific issues within the vehicle.

  • P Codes (Powertrain): Relate to the engine, transmission, and related components.
  • B Codes (Body): Involve the body control systems, such as airbags and power windows.
  • C Codes (Chassis): Pertain to the chassis systems, including ABS and traction control.
  • U Codes (Network): Refer to communication issues within the vehicle’s network.

For example, a “P0300” code indicates a random or multiple cylinder misfire. Once you have the code, you can research the issue and determine the necessary repairs.

4.3. Clearing Codes and Resetting the System

After addressing the issue, you can clear the DTCs using the OBD2 scanner. This turns off the check engine light and resets the system.

  1. Select “Clear Codes”: Navigate to the “Clear Codes” or “Erase Codes” option on the scanner.
  2. Confirm the Action: Follow the prompts to confirm that you want to clear the codes.
  3. Verify the Result: Start the engine and ensure the check engine light remains off.

Note: Clearing codes without fixing the underlying issue will only result in the codes reappearing.

6. Advanced OBD2 Functions for Mercedes C-Class

For advanced users, OBD2 scanners offer features beyond basic code reading and clearing. These functions can provide deeper insights into your vehicle’s performance.

6.1. Live Data Streaming

Live data streaming allows you to monitor real-time parameters from your vehicle’s sensors, such as:

  • Engine RPM: Revolutions per minute of the engine.
  • Coolant Temperature: Temperature of the engine coolant.
  • Vehicle Speed: Current speed of the vehicle.
  • Fuel Trim: Adjustments made to the fuel mixture by the ECU.
  • O2 Sensor Readings: Readings from the oxygen sensors.

Monitoring these parameters can help identify intermittent issues and diagnose performance problems.

6.2. Bidirectional Control

Bidirectional control allows you to send commands to the vehicle’s components to test their functionality. This can include:

  • Activating Solenoids: Testing transmission solenoids or fuel injectors.
  • Cycling ABS Pump: Testing the ABS system.
  • Turning on Lights: Testing the headlights or taillights.

This feature requires a more advanced OBD2 scanner and a thorough understanding of the vehicle’s systems.

6.3. ABS/SRS Diagnostics

Advanced scanners can also diagnose issues with the ABS (Anti-lock Braking System) and SRS (Supplemental Restraint System) systems. This can include:

  • Reading ABS Codes: Identifying issues with the ABS sensors or pump.
  • Reading SRS Codes: Identifying issues with the airbags or seatbelt pretensioners.

These systems are critical for safety, so proper diagnosis and repair are essential.

6.4. Module Programming

Some advanced OBD2 scanners can perform module programming, which involves updating or replacing the software in the vehicle’s electronic control units (ECUs). This can be necessary after replacing a faulty module or to update the ECU with the latest software.

Note: Module programming should only be performed by experienced technicians, as incorrect programming can cause serious issues.

8. Troubleshooting Common OBD2 Scanner Issues

While OBD2 scanners are generally reliable, you may encounter issues from time to time. Here are some common problems and how to troubleshoot them.

8.1. Scanner Won’t Connect

  • Check the Connection: Ensure the scanner is securely plugged into the OBD2 port.
  • Verify Power: Make sure the scanner is powered on and has sufficient battery life.
  • Check the Port: Inspect the OBD2 port for any damage or debris.
  • Try Another Vehicle: Test the scanner on another vehicle to rule out a scanner issue.

8.2. Incorrect Codes

  • Verify the Vehicle Information: Ensure you have selected the correct make, model, and year of your vehicle.
  • Check for Updates: Update the scanner’s software to ensure you have the latest codes.
  • Consult a Mechanic: If you’re unsure about the codes, consult a professional mechanic.

8.3. Scanner Freezing

  • Restart the Scanner: Try restarting the scanner to clear any temporary issues.
  • Check for Updates: Update the scanner’s software to fix any bugs.
  • Contact Support: Contact the scanner manufacturer for support.

8.4. No Codes Found

  • Ensure Ignition is On: Make sure the ignition is turned to the “on” position without starting the engine.
  • Check for Power: Verify that the scanner is receiving power from the vehicle.
  • Try Another Scanner: If possible, try another scanner to rule out a scanner issue.
